引言Vue.js 作为一款流行的前端框架,以其简洁的语法和高效的组件系统受到了众多开发者的喜爱。为了进一步提升开发效率和项目质量,合理利用Vue.js的插件变得尤为重要。本文将详细介绍几款Vue.js...
Vue.js 作为一款流行的前端框架,以其简洁的语法和高效的组件系统受到了众多开发者的喜爱。为了进一步提升开发效率和项目质量,合理利用Vue.js的插件变得尤为重要。本文将详细介绍几款Vue.js必备插件,并通过实战案例展示如何使用这些插件来优化项目开发。
Vue.js 插件是扩展 Vue.js 功能的模块,它们可以增强 Vue.js 的功能,提供额外的工具和功能。以下是一些常用的 Vue.js 插件:
Vetur 插件为 Vue.js 开发者提供了强大的代码编辑支持。以下是如何使用 Vetur 提升编码效率的步骤:
.vscode/settings.json 文件,添加以下配置:{ "vetur.format.defaultFormatter.html": "js-beautify", "vetur.format.defaultFormatter.js": "esbenp.prettier-vscode", "vetur.format.defaultFormatter.css": "prettier", "vetur.format.defaultFormatter.sass": "sass", "vetur.format.defaultFormatter.scss": "sass", "vetur.format.defaultFormatter.stylus": "stylus", "vetur.format.defaultFormatter.ts": "typescript", "vetur.format.defaultFormatter.tsx": "typescriptreact"
}ESLint 插件可以帮助开发者保持代码风格一致,并发现潜在的错误。以下是如何使用 ESLint 的步骤:
.eslintrc.js 文件,并添加以下配置:module.exports = { root: true, parser: 'vue-eslint-parser', parserOptions: { parser: 'babel-eslint', }, env: { browser: true, node: true, es6: true, }, extends: ['plugin:vue/vue3-essential', 'eslint:recommended'], rules: { // 自定义规则 },
};Prettier 插件可以帮助开发者保持代码风格一致,并自动格式化代码。以下是如何使用 Prettier 的步骤:
.prettierrc 文件,并添加以下配置:{ "semi": true, "singleQuote": true, "trailingComma": "es5", "tabWidth": 2, "printWidth": 80, "useTabs": false
}Vue Devtools 插件允许开发者实时查看和调试 Vue.js 应用程序。以下是如何使用 Vue Devtools 的步骤:
Live Server 插件可以自动启动本地服务器并打开浏览器,方便开发者实时预览代码。以下是如何使用 Live Server 的步骤:
通过使用 Vue.js 必备插件,开发者可以轻松提升项目效率,保持代码风格一致,并发现潜在的错误。本文介绍了 Vetur、ESLint、Prettier、Vue Devtools 和 Live Server 等插件的使用方法,并通过实战案例展示了如何使用这些插件来优化项目开发。希望这些技巧能够帮助开发者更好地使用 Vue.js 进行项目开发。